Get out for a day of exploring the Basque Region with this tour from Bilbao. You'll visit the historic city of San Sebastian where you embark on a walking tour and visit Mount Igeldo. Then explore Saint Jean de Luz before visiting the chic beaches of Biarritz.

Even though this was an enjoyable tour, with a very good, informative guide and driver, it was NOT as advertised. The tour runs only on Sundays but once we were on the tour we were told NO vehicles are allowed in Biarritz on Sundays, so we would have to make do with a stop for a view above the town. The driver did try and ask for permission but we were not allowed. Also the advertised boat trip did not happen because there was not enough time. We did have time however to do drop offs for other tours. I have tried to find somewhere on this site to register a complaint but there does not seem to be a way.

Dear client,
Please note that the traffic restrictions in Biarritz are always the first sunday of the month and sadly, we can not do nothing about. Regarding to the boat tour, sometimes, we have to avoid it in order to offer more free time for lunch in Hondarribia and a more relaxed afternoon in San Sebastian. Hope you had a nice experience!
